    Well I haven't investigated the claim, but if this is true he did request the government pay for painting and repairing his house.

    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th is looking to live in military family housing and requested to use $137,000 in taxpayer funding for repairs -- including nearly $50,000 for an "emergency" paint job -- a pair of top Democratic lawmakers said in a letter Friday demanding more details.
